进入正文

集成三星 Z-SSD 后的 Scylla 性能

  • 邮件
下载
基于三星 Z-SSD 与 DRAM 的 Scylla 性能对比研究 有关三星 Z-SSD 超低延迟 Z-SSD 固态硬盘的最新分析显示,此款最近发布的硬盘与 Scylla 数据存储集成后会获得显著性能提升。在该白皮书中,三星就高性能开源 NoSQL 数据存储 Scylla 集成 Z-SSD 后的性能与基于内存中体系结构的性能作出了详细的对比研究。本研究还比较了这两种解决方案的成本效益。 由于 Z-SSD 的嵌入式 NAND、SSD 控制器和 SSD 内存经过数项垂直优化,因此与当今主流的 NVMe SSD 相比,Z-SSD 的延迟不及其五分之一。 Scylla 具有设计精良的 C++ 实现,在本测试中用作 Cassandra 的直接替代品。我们比较了处理来自内存的请求以及处理来自三星 Z-SSD 的请求时 Scylla 的性能。为此,我们使用常用的 Cassandra 压力测试工具描述系统性能、整体吞吐量和延迟。本白皮书介绍我们的研究结果,并包含如下结论: • 三星 Z-SSD 缩小了处理内存中数据和处理 SSD 中数据之间的性能差异。 • 基于具有亚毫秒级约束的最大吞吐量、95 百分位数延迟以及 Z-SSD 提供的 50% 的请求,我们发现,Z-SSD 与内存中运行之间的差异对于只读工作负载而言仅为 44%,对于混合工作负载(75% 读取,25% 写入)仅为 40%。 • 虽然 Scylla 提供高性能的 NoSQL 服务,但是软件堆栈开销非常高,是使用 FIO 测量的原始设备延迟所需开销的 6 - 7 倍。后续软件层优化有望将 SSD 和内存性能差异降低至更低水平。 • 我们的性价比成本模型提供有关存储系统成本效益的见解,并会重点突出最值得注意的区域,在该区域中,Z-SSD 十分有助于构建极具成本效益的服务器系统。 关于 Scylla ScyllaDB 是全球最快速的 NoSQL 数据库。Scylla 完全兼容 Apache Cassandra,其采用的非共享方式使其吞吐量和存储能力为 Cassandra 的10 倍。AppNexus、三星、蘑菇街、Outbrain、Kenshoo、Olacabs、Investing.com、Eniro、IBM 旗下的 Compose 以及其他众多龙头公司纷纷采用 Scylla,以实现数量级的性能提升并降低硬件成本。ScyllaDB 由负责 KVM 虚拟机监控程序的团队所建立,受 Bessemer Venture Partners、Innovation Endeavors、Wing Venture Capital、Qualcomm Ventures、Magma Venture Partners、Western Digital Capital 和 Samsung Ventures 支持。 若要详细了解本研究(包括方法学和性能结果),请点击下方链接下载本白皮书。

本网站的产品图片以及型号、数据、功能、性能、规格参数等仅供参考,三星有可能对上述内容进行改进,具体信息请参照产品实物、产品说明书。除非经特殊说明,本网站中所涉及的数据均为三星内部测试结果,所涉及的对比,均为与三星传统产品相比较.